Questions & Answers
Q: What are the key features of LoRaWAN that make it unique?
LoRaWAN stands out due to its ultra-low power consumption, long range capabilities, support for geolocation, ability to deploy both public and private networks, end-to-end security, and firmware updates over the air.
Q: How does LoRaWAN ensure security?
LoRaWAN provides security through authentication, integrity, and confidentiality. It utilizes AES 128-bit keys for encryption, ensures data integrity and authenticity through session keys, and supports secure connections between devices, gateways, network servers, and application servers.
Q: What is the difference between LoRa and LoRaWAN?
LoRa is the physical layer, responsible for transmitting data over long distances using chirp spread spectrum modulation. LoRaWAN, on the other hand, is the protocol built on top of LoRa, providing network and security features for IoT applications.
Q: Can LoRaWAN be used in any region?
LoRaWAN can be used globally, but the specific frequencies and regulations vary by region. The protocol has regional parameters that specify the frequencies and other limitations for each supported region, ensuring compliance with local regulations.
Q: How does LoRaWAN handle range and interference?
LoRaWAN is known for its long range capabilities, thanks to the use of sub-gigahertz frequencies and chirp spread spectrum modulation. It is also highly immune to interference, allowing for robust communication even in the presence of other signals.
Summary & Key Takeaways
-
LoRaWAN is a powerful communication technology with unique features such as ultra-low power consumption, long range, and support for both public and private networks.
-
The protocol utilizes the license-free spectrum and supports geolocation, firmware updates over the air, and a large ecosystem of device manufacturers, gateway makers, and application developers.
-
LoRaWAN finds applications in various verticals, including natural disaster prevention, agriculture, industrial monitoring, smart cities, supply chain management, and smart metering.
